## Webhook Delivery Retries — Marlette Release Runbook

During a release, webhook consumers may see duplicate deliveries: the dispatcher retries with exponential backoff (5 attempts, jittered, capped at 10 minutes) and does not deduplicate across restarts. Consumers must treat deliveries as at-least-once and verify each payload's signature before processing. Rotate nothing mid-release; the verifier and dispatcher must agree on the active signing key for the entire window. That active key follows below.

signing key of yajog-kafof = bky19_orbYRY3Abj3KpZesMie

Internal Memo — For the Incoming Director

Quick heads-up before you start: we've paused all hiring in the Fieldworks division at Brastow & Hale. Open reqs are frozen, not cancelled, and the three offers already out will be honored. Managers know; morale is okay but watchful. The reasoning ties into plans we haven't announced yet, which are summarized below.

board note of tawip-hahip: Only 7 of the 80 pilot accounts renewed Ralath, so a churn review is set for April 1.

Attendees: Halden, Mireille, Tobas, Quinn. Apologies: Veska.

1. Franchise agreement with Copperlane Eatery Group reviewed. Royalty set at 6% of gross, territory limited to the Ardwell corridor. Legal flagged the exclusivity clause; revision due Thursday.
2. Finance to model cash impact of the onboarding fee waiver for the first three locations.
3. Tobas confirmed build-out costs stay within the approved envelope.
4. Signing targeted for month-end.

Rationale and downstream commitments are recorded in the confidential note below.

board note of kageg-bahof: The renewal with Holwynax Holdings closes at $2 million a year, 5 percent below the last contract. Project Ulaath slips by two quarters because of the supplier delay.

Quarterly Planning Note — Hiring Freeze, Instrumentation Division

For the board: effective this quarter, Ashgrove Dynamics will pause all external hiring in the Instrumentation Division. Attrition will not be backfilled except for safety-critical roles, subject to executive approval. Cost modelling indicates savings sufficient to protect the Halverton programme. The confidential note on how this supports our wider plans follows below.

confidential, haduf-bagap: The renewal with Zorixix Holdings closes at $20 million a year, 5 percent below the last contract. Project Ralix slips by two quarters because of the staffing delay.